LogoBETABeta
Insurmountable Wall

Physical: Asia

Season 1Episode 6Aired 2025-11-04
Insurmountable Wall

Insurmountable Wall

Racing against time and heavy loads, teams face more than a contest — it's a true test of endurance. Losing teams must break their own torsos right away.